Application And Research For Piezoelectric Bimorphs In Measuring Intraocular Pressure

Intraocular pressure is an important gist in diagnose(such as glaucoma) ,and is one of the important guidelines in observing state of an illness,estimating curative effect and appraising prognosis.Some of the clinic application of tonometer which based on traditional measure have applied many times,but there are more or less flaws on them.For example:high measuring expense,needing other assistent equipment and so on.The thesis uses bimorphs to bring a new way to measure the Intraocular Pressure.The main job are design of driving circuit of bimorphs,the basal hard-ware circuit,the measuring settings and the soft-ware for analysing data.The thesis firstly introduces the theory of bimorphs,and then put forward the total method.The hole system has 4 parts.The first one is design of driving circuit.This part mainly transforms and deals with the signal,so that it can drives bimorphs safetly,steadily and accurately;The seconde one is basall hard-ware circuit.It makes all system keep running steadily;The third one is the measuring settings.This part analyses how to establish the measuring settings and the measured-object in detail.It includes choosing and fixing up the measured-object and so on;The fourth one is the soft-ware for analysing data and modeling,and the last we can establish a lineary formula to reckon the pressure of the measured-object directly.The result shows that it was effective to use bimorphs to measure Intraocular pressure.And meanwhile we have established the relationship of the circuit passing through bimorphs and pressure in eyes.This equipment shows the new measuring method and the equipment is handy in using,practicability and differentiality.So that it makes great sense in medical research and clinic application.
